Abstract
A system to enable restoration of a tree structure based on serialized data, and extraction of partial data that includes information of the tree structure from original data. A searching part identifies sequence elements of serialized data using a searching process. An essential element string identifying part identifies a sequence element string (essential element string) that includes the searched sequence elements. A rear section identifying part identifies a sequence element string that includes sequence elements located after the essential element string and is required to form a subtree that includes nodes corresponding to all the sequence elements of the essential element string. A front section identifying part identifies a sequence element string that includes sequence elements located before the essential element string and is required to form a subtree that includes nodes corresponding to all the sequence elements of the essential element string.
